The Story So Far
Confederation of Indian Industry (CII), in partnership with the Ministry of MSME and NSIC is organising Vendor Development Programme for MSMEs in Kochi on 22 February 2019. Given that, MSMEs are bogged down by considerable constraints that dwarf their growth potential, a robust supply relationship with Central and State Public Sector Undertakings (PSUs) as well as large enterprises (OEMs) present a significant opportunity for MSMEs by addressing their issue of inadequate market access and linkages. Ministry of MSME’s notified Public Procurement Policy 2012 for MSMEs aims to promote the growth and development of MSMEs in India by integrating it with domestic supply chain. With the objective of achieving mandatory procurement goal of minimum 25% and a sub target of 4% procurement of goods and services by SC/ST entrepreneurs. In this context, Confederation of Indian Industry (CII), in partnership with the Ministry of MSME and NSIC is organising Vendor Development Programme with D-Link
